Preventing and Combating Trafficking in Human Beings and Protecting its Victims (Directive 2011/36/EU)

First page of directive 2011/36/UE

21/09/2012

On 5 April 2011, the European Union adopted Directive 2011/36/EU which sets out minimum standards to be applied throughout the European Union in preventing and combating trafficking in human beings and protecting victims.

New instructions introduce return track for asylum seekers in reception facilities

logo Fedasil

01/08/2012

The law of January 19, 2012 introduced the concept of a “return track” for asylum seekers, a framework for individual counseling on return, offered by the Federal Agency for the Reception of Asylum Seekers (Fedasil). New instructions implement this return track in the reception centres.

New Law transposing the Return Directive

Belgian flag

17/02/2012

The new Belgian Law of January 19, 2012 (published on 17 February 2012) transposes the EU Return Directive, modifying the current legal framework on removal and detention, and putting more emphasis on voluntary departure.
